GRPA’s Youth Sports Official Training Program provides an affordable pathway for individuals interested in officiating youth sports in their local communities. The program helps prepare new officials while supporting agencies across Georgia in building a stronger pool of trained youth sports officials.

Local recreation agencies and sports leagues are in desperate need for youth sports officials. This training program will be tailored to allow local citizens take this training course and officiate local youth sports leagues in their community. The online officiating training program will be available to local community citizens in Georgia beginning in 2026.
Why are youth sports officials needed?
- Ensuring Fair Play- Trained officials maintain the integrity of the game, ensuring rules are followed
- Safety- Officials are crucial in enforcing safety regulations, preventing injuries
- Skill Development- Serving as an official helps youth development leadership, responsibility, and decision-making skills
- Community building- Youth sports officials can inspire peers to participate, fostering a strong community spirit around sports
- Encourage advancement- Gain valuable experience as a youth sports official to encourage officials to join the High School Association
- Enhance local recreation programs- training local community citizens to officiate at the local community level to help serve shortages
